About the role

Southern Water is delivering one of the most ambitious investment programmes in the sector improving environmental performance strengthening resilience and creating lasting benefits for customers and communities.

Were looking for an experienced Strategic Programme Lead to lead our Bioresources investment portfolio valued at approximately 300m-400m including our Industrial Emissions Directive programme and the development of three new advanced digestion sites in Kent.

This is a high-profile role at the heart of our AMP8 plans. Youll bring together delivery asset management operations commercial and finance teams to achieve complex regulatory and business outcomes while leading a significant market engagement exercise for a design build operate finance and maintain delivery model.

Youll own the programme business case and Strategic Programme Execution Plan maintaining pace and making balanced decisions across cost risk and performance. Operating through a matrix structure rather than direct line management youll create the conditions for cross-functional teams and external partners to perform at their best.

This is a rare opportunity to shape major infrastructure investment introduce new commercial delivery approaches and make a tangible difference to the environment and the communities we serve.

About Southern Water

Southern Water is at the forefront of transforming Britains water industry investing significantly to enhance resilience sustainability and service excellence. With 7.8bn planned investment for 2025-30 this is an unparalleled opportunity to join a business committed to delivering a generational shift in the way water services are managed.
